Abstract

The invention relates to a manufacturing method of a multifunctional environmental-friendly diatom mud wall material. The manufacturing method is characterized in that the multifunctional environmental-friendly diatom mud wall material is prepared from the following materials including diatom mud, calcium carbonate powder, calcined kaolin, sepiolite powder, zeolite powder, silicon spars, titanium dioxide powder, anti-cracking fibers, natural inorganic pigments, polyvinyl alcohol, polyvinylpyrrolidone, cellulose ether and a thickener. By virtue of the manufacturing method, the disadvantages in the prior art of small material selection range, complex manufacturing process, high energy consumption, poor batch stability in quality of products, difficulty in storage and the like are overcome; the prepared product has the characteristics of absorbing and decomposing formaldehyde, eliminating pollution, regulating humidity for respiration, releasing negative oxygen ions, absorbing sound, lowering noise, sterilizing, disinfecting, removing peculiar smell, preventing fire, retarding flame, raising eyes by delustering, self cleaning the wall surface, eliminating static electricity and the like.

Summary of the invention
Object of the present invention, be to provide one to draw materials extensively, concise in technology, energy-conserving and environment-protective, the manufacture method of multifunction environment-protection type diatom ooze wall material applied widely, overcomes material selection range in prior art little, and manufacturing process is complicated, energy consumption is high, quality product lot stability is poor, not easily the shortcoming such as storage.
A manufacture method for multifunction environment-protection type diatom ooze wall material, is characterized in that, its step is as follows:
1) quality of diatomite, Paris white, calcined kaolin, sepiolite powder, zeolite powder, silicon wafer stone, titanium dioxide powder, defend and split fibre, inorganic natural pigment, polyvinyl alcohol, polyvinylpyrrolidone, ether of cellulose and thickening material as requested, the raw material of screening appropriate particle size;
2) diatomite, Paris white, calcined kaolin, silicon wafer stone and titanium dioxide powder are joined in stirrer be uniformly mixed, until stir;
3) mixture stirred is added to the water, and stirring adds polyvinylpyrrolidone, formed and be suspended dispersion liquid;
4) sepiolite powder, zeolite powder, defend and split fibre and inorganic natural pigment are joined be suspended in dispersion liquid, and stir, make raw material be evenly distributed in suspension liquid;
5) heat suspension liquid, continue to stir, until formed thin viscous while evaporation suspension liquid;
6) be cooled to room temperature, add polyvinyl alcohol, ether of cellulose and thickening material, add strong mixing, raw material is evenly distributed in rare magma;
7) reheat rare magma, and constantly stir, until form pasty state.
Wherein, described diatomite, Paris white, calcined kaolin, sepiolite powder, zeolite powder, silicon wafer stone, titanium dioxide powder, defend and split fibre, inorganic natural pigment, polyvinyl alcohol, polyvinylpyrrolidone, the mass ratio of ether of cellulose and thickening material is diatomite 10%-45%, Paris white 4%-30%, calcined kaolin 6%-20%, sepiolite powder 7%-15%, zeolite powder 6%-15%, silicon wafer stone 10%-30%, titanium dioxide powder 3%-28%, defend and split fibre 0.05%-0.2%, inorganic natural pigment 0.1%-15%, polyvinyl alcohol 2%-5%, polyvinylpyrrolidone 0.01%-0.1%, ether of cellulose 2%-4%, thickening material 1%-2%.
Wherein, described diatomite selects 700-900 object diatomite, and described calcium carbonate selects 800-1250 object Paris white, and described zeolite powder selects 1000-1250 object zeolite powder, and described silicon wafer stone selects 20-120 object silicon wafer stone.
Wherein, described polyvinylpyrrolidone adopts specification to be the polyvinylpyrrolidone of K-90.

The manufacture method of embodiment 1, a kind of multifunction environment-protection type diatom ooze wall material, its step is as follows:
1) diatomite 45kg, Paris white 17.75kg, calcined kaolin 6kg, sepiolite powder 7kg, zeolite powder 6kg, silicon wafer stone 10kg, titanium dioxide powder 3kg, defend and split fibre 0.05kg, inorganic natural pigment 0.1kg, polyvinyl alcohol 2kg, polyvinylpyrrolidone 0.1kg, ether of cellulose 2kg and thickening material 1kg as requested, diatomite selects 700 object diatomite, described calcium carbonate selects 800 object Paris whites, described zeolite powder selects 1000 object zeolite powders, and described silicon wafer stone selects 20 object silicon wafer stones;
2) diatomite, Paris white, calcined kaolin, silicon wafer stone and titanium dioxide powder are joined in stirrer be uniformly mixed, until stir;
3) mixture stirred is added to the water, and stirring adds polyvinylpyrrolidone, formed and be suspended dispersion liquid;
4) sepiolite powder, zeolite powder, defend and split fibre and inorganic natural pigment are joined be suspended in dispersion liquid, and stir, make raw material be evenly distributed in suspension liquid;
5) heat suspension liquid, continue to stir, until formed thin viscous while evaporation suspension liquid;
6) be cooled to room temperature, add polyvinyl alcohol, ether of cellulose and thickening material, add strong mixing, raw material is evenly distributed in rare magma;
7) reheat rare magma, and constantly stir, until form pasty state.
Diatom ooze wall material prepared by method of the present invention have absorb decomposing formaldehyde, order is supported in decontamination, breathing damping, releasing negative oxygen ion, absorbing sound and lowering noise, sterilization and disinfection, removal peculiar smell, fire protection flame retarding, delustring, metope is self-cleaning, eliminate the features such as electrostatic.
